Managing Emotional Complexity When Relationships Evolve Unexpectedly

As individuals navigate their way through life's transitions, they may find themselves in situations where their romantic or platonic relationship status shifts. These changes can be both exciting and challenging to manage, especially when they come without warning.

There are several strategies that can help individuals successfully manage these changes while maintaining healthy emotional wellbeing.

One strategy for managing emotional complexity is to communicate openly and honestly with your partner. It is important to express your feelings and needs, both positive and negative, in order to establish trust and understanding. This can be difficult, but it is essential for building a strong foundation for the future. Another approach is to set boundaries and expectations early on in the relationship. By clearly defining what each person expects from the other, it is easier to avoid misunderstandings later on.

It is helpful to practice self-care activities such as meditation, exercise, or therapy to reduce stress and anxiety associated with change.

Another effective method is to seek support from friends, family members, or professionals who understand the challenges of evolving relationships. Talking to others who have experienced similar situations can provide valuable insights and perspectives. Seeking professional help can also address underlying issues that may contribute to the emotional intensity surrounding a changing relationship.

It is crucial to remember that relationships take work and effort. While some aspects may happen naturally, it takes active engagement to maintain healthy communication and intimacy.

Managing emotional complexity during unexpected relationship transitions requires intentionality and dedication. By communicating effectively, setting clear boundaries, seeking support, and actively working towards improving the relationship, individuals can navigate this time with grace and resilience.

How do individuals manage emotional complexity when relational roles evolve unexpectedly?

Individuals may experience various emotions such as shock, disorientation, confusion, and anxiety when their relational roles change suddenly or unexpectedly. To cope with this situation, they can engage in self-reflection and introspection to understand their feelings, identify their needs and desires, and explore different ways of coping with the new situation.
